2026 在租用的 Mac mini M4 16GB 上完成 OpenClaw onboard 之后:doctor 验收、六区 Webhook POP、256GB 缓存闸口与可搜索 FAQ 矩阵
如果你在 KvmZone 租用的 Mac mini M4 16GB 上已经跑通 OpenClaw onboard,但工单里仍出现「偶发 webhook 504」「doctor 半绿半黄」「256GB 系统盘莫名其妙见底」,那么问题通常不在 README,而在装完以后没人把证据链写进同一页 SLA。本文给财务能看懂的「装完以后」审计边界;冒烟通过后的典型痛清单;四列表 doctor 证据矩阵;香港、日本、韩国、新加坡、美国东部、美国西部六节点语境下的 Webhook POP 适配表;npm 与技能盘闸口;七步 SSH 验收;以及并联 staging 何时胜过继续单机调参。安装当天请交叉阅读 5 月 13 日第零小时合约;稳定期守护进程卫生见 5 月 15 日定常 runbook。生产 webhook 放量前请配置 OpenClaw 硬熔断与预算报警。套餐与节点在 定价页,远程基线在 帮助中心,像素会话门槛在 VNC 说明。
结构说明:先冻结「装完以后」要证明什么;再列痛点;再用 doctor 矩阵把黄灯翻译成工单;再用区域表把延迟从玄学变地理;再用磁盘闸口把「神秘变慢」拆成可审计数字;最后给七步验收与 FAQ,便于你直接粘进飞书文档。
「装完以后」审计边界:不是重复 onboard,而是证明 SLA
装完以后的验收对象从「安装器是否返回 0」迁移到「守护进程用户是否与交互用户一致」「非登录 shell 是否仍能找到全局 CLI」「webhook 回调路径是否把控制面与数据面拉得太远」。审计边界建议写进 wiki 的三条硬结果:(1) 同一台主机在交互 SSH 与 launchd 拉起的会话中各执行一次 openclaw doctor,输出差异为空或已在工单解释;(2) 从你们 CI 或聊天机器人所在区域到本机的一次 webhook 试跑,记录 wall-clock 与重试次数;(3) 系统卷 APFS 可用空间在技能启用前后都高于 18GB,若低于该值,先在 定价页 讨论 1TB/2TB 扩容,而不是追加「神秘优化任务」。
冒烟绿了之后的典型痛:为什么团队仍觉得「慢」
- 黄灯被忽略:
openclaw doctor在笔记本全绿,在租用的非登录 shell 里却提示 PATH 或 TLS 存储差异——于是「能跑」只在工程师手敲时成立。 - Webhook 地理错配:控制面在新加坡,回调却要绕美西 SaaS 再回香港 Mac,RTT 被误读成「OpenClaw 性能差」。
- 磁盘型变慢:
~/.npm与技能缓存把 256GB 入门盘顶到 APFS 高压区,swap 行为与统一内存压力联动,表象像网络抖动。统一内存缓解阶梯见 5 月 12 日手册。 - 网关争用:试验性技能与生产 webhook 共用同一接收端口,日志里表现为间歇性背压。
doctor 与状态证据矩阵:把黄灯翻成可分配任务
下列矩阵刻意使用四列,避免与「第零小时」五列表完全同构;每一行都应对一个可指派的工单字段。2026 年上游安装器仍推荐 Node 22 或更高运行时;若你使用官方 curl -fsSL https://openclaw.ai/install.sh | bash 一键路径,请在工单同时记录它与 npm install -g openclaw@latest 是否指向同一套二进制,以免混 PATH。
| 检查项 | 期望信号 | 常见根因 | 修复优先级 |
|---|---|---|---|
openclaw doctor |
交互与非交互会话输出一致且无未解释警告 | 非登录 shell 未加载 PATH;或两套 Node 并存 |
P0:阻塞 webhook 验收 |
openclaw status / 进程存活 |
守护进程崩溃后在 90 秒 内自恢复或按 runbook 告警 | launchd ThrottleInterval 过短;日志卷 IO 饱和 |
P1:影响稳定性 KPI |
| TLS / 时钟 | 与上游授权端点握手无重试风暴;系统时钟与 CI 差小于 120 秒 | 容器化依赖把时区假设带到 macOS;NTP 未对齐 | P0:令牌刷新失败伪装成业务错误 |
| 磁盘余量 | df -h / Avail 持续高于 18GB(同日二次编译预留 28GB) |
npm 缓存、技能产物、日志同卷竞争 | P0:触及即应先扩容再谈功能 |
六区 Webhook POP 适配:把「区域」从营销词变成延迟预算
KvmZone 提供香港、日本、韩国、新加坡、美国东部、美国西部等裸金属 Apple Silicon 节点。下面用三列表达「如果你的控制面在…而回调从…」时的工程建议;数值区间是预算规划用的数量级,请在你们真实链路上用同一探针复测后替换为内部基线。
| 控制面所在区域 | 回调发起区域 | 工程建议 |
|---|---|---|
| 亚太(香港 / 东京 / 首尔 / 新加坡) | 美国东部 SaaS | 把 Mac 网关放在离回调入口更近的节点,或把试验环境拆到第二台同区域主机,避免「跨太平洋双跳」混进性能回归。 |
| 美国西部 | 欧洲或中东团队触发的 webhook | 评估是否把生产网关东移到美国东部,再保留美西作为构建沙盒;否则把 SLA 写成「美西单点」而非抱怨 OpenClaw。 |
| 新加坡 | 东南亚用户即时交互 | 优先同区域 Mac;若 doctor 已绿但仍超 2500ms p95,应先查磁盘与 swap,而不是先换框架。 |
| 香港 | 内地办公室出口 + 企业代理 | 在工单记录代理对 TLS 检查的影响;必要时为守护进程单独配置 HTTPS_PROXY,与交互 shell 对齐。 |
npm 与技能盘闸口:256GB 入门 SKU 上的可审计阈值
在 256GB 系统卷上,OpenClaw 的技能目录与 npm 缓存共享 APFS 的碎片化行为;当可用空间跌穿阈值时,统一内存与 swap 的耦合会把延迟放大成「像网络坏了」。建议把下面两张硬闸口写进变更评审表。
- 若
du -sh ~/.npm报告超过约 4.5GB 且周环比增长超过 15%,触发一次有记录的npm cache verify与 prune 计划,而不是无限扩容技能。 - 若技能工作区与日志目录合计周增长超过约 6GB,在评审表对比 定价页 上的 1TB/2TB 附加项与「第二台并联低价实例」总账,引用 5 月 14 日租期×并联矩阵 作为附录。
SSH 验收七步:装完以后第一天可照抄的工单
- 在交互式 SSH 会话运行
openclaw doctor,保存完整输出到工单附件 A。 - 用与
launchd相同的用户与非登录 shell 再跑一次 doctor,保存为附件 B;若 A/B 不一致,先修 PATH 与 plist 环境变量。 - 记录
df -h /与du -sh ~/.npm、技能根目录、日志目录四行数字。 - 从 CI 或机器人所在区域发起一次 webhook 试跑,保存 wall-clock、HTTP 状态码与重试次数。
- 对照本节前的六区表,写下「若延迟超预算,第一步是搬迁节点还是拆分网关」的决策句。
- 阅读 帮助中心 的 SSH 基线,确认仅当满足像素会话门槛时才打开 VNC。
- 把附件 A/B 与四行磁盘数字链接到财务能检索的租赁发票行项目,完成「装完以后」闭环。
若你需要更细的守护进程与日志轮转范式,请回到 5 月 15 日定常 runbook 对照 weekly audit;它与本文矩阵是上下游关系,而不是二选一。
并联 staging 决策:何时新开一台便宜实例胜过继续调参
当 doctor 已绿、磁盘余量健康,但生产 webhook 与试验性技能仍共享同一接收端口且日志出现周期性背压,把试验流量搬到第二台同区域低价实例通常比继续堆复杂路由更便宜——因为你们买的是「隔离故障域」,不是再买一次 onboard 教程。staging 与生产应共享同一区域,否则你会把地理延迟混进 A/B 比较;若团队同时需要 Git 多仓浅克隆策略,请并列阅读 5 月 18 日 Git 磁盘矩阵 以免第二台主机重复踩盘。
常见问题:把搜索词直接映射到动作
onboard 成功但 webhook 仍偶发 504,该先看 doctor 还是先看区域?先看 doctor 是否提示时钟、TLS 或守护进程用户不一致;若 doctor 全绿,再用六区 POP 表核对控制面与回调的地理关系。
256GB 入门盘要留多少余量给 npm 与技能缓存?启用重磁盘技能前,系统卷可用空间应持续高于约 18GB;若 ~/.npm 单独超过约 4.5GB 且仍在增长,应安排有记录的缓存治理。
curl 安装器与 npm 全局并存会坏吗?可以并存,但 PATH 与 launchd 环境必须只指向一套真相;混用时常表现为交互 shell 成功、守护进程失败。
何时用第二台低价实例做 staging?当单机上 doctor 已绿、但生产 webhook 与试验性技能共享同一网关进程且日志显示争用时;staging 应放在与生产相同区域。
为何 Mac mini M4 仍能支撑「装完以后」叙事
Apple Silicon M4 在统一内存架构下为 Node 22 时代的原生扩展与并发 webhook 提供了可预测的延迟特征;Neural Engine 与高能效比让长时间守护进程不必为了「像服务器」而牺牲笔记本级温控。macOS 原生环境意味着签名、钥匙串与像素会话门槛都落在 Apple 支持的路径上,而不是在 x86 云里拼装近似物。通过 KvmZone 租用香港、日本、韩国、新加坡、美国东部或美国西部的 Mac mini,你可以把「区域」写进 SLA 表并与发票行项目对齐,而不必先把 CAPEX 押在机房采购上。当 OpenClaw 从玩具变成工单系统时,这种可搬迁、可审计、可按天到按季弹性计费的组合,往往比一次性买机更适合验证中的团队——尤其是你已经读完本文矩阵,仍想把预算花在证据而不是口号上时。
把「装完以后」写进 SLA,而不是写进聊天记录
在定价页锁定节点与磁盘档,再打开帮助中心把 SSH 基线与 launchd 环境对齐;仅当像素会话不可避免时使用 VNC 说明页。